TEN CARAT DIAMOND
(Slagle 2013) The white iris to trump all white irises, here and now. It's no news that I’ve got a beef with white bearded irises. They too often lack substance, are uninspiringly blah blah, and too often look like every other white iris ever introduced--white with a bit of ruffle and lace. Meh. ‘Ten Carat Diamond’ on the other hand throws up flowers that could easily be mistaken for gold-gilted, saccharine white plastic. Rugged, beautiful, and altogether hot, this white iris deserves a place in gardens for its ruggedly feminine beauty and outstanding vigor. Gary’s got a superb eye for show-quality stalks, but doesn’t forget to breed into his irises tough stems so those flower-laden branches don’t collapse on themselves. In a word — exceptional. A steal at $40.00. Parentage: Helen Dawn x Venetian Glass
